We collect details needed to create and protect your account, such as contact data, login records, device signals and verification records linked to account access.

When you use JazzCash or Easypaisa, our privacy records may include transaction references, status checks and support messages, but not wallet passwords or PINs.

Yes, cookies may keep sessions active, remember preferences and help us understand site performance. Cookie use is linked to the privacy purposes described here.

Contact privacy support with the record you want corrected. We may ask for verification before changing contact data, identity details or transaction-linked account records.

Retention depends on account activity, verification needs, support history and legal record duties. When keeping data is no longer needed, we restrict or remove it.

We may share data with service providers that support account security, payment verification, hosting or customer help, and only for privacy purposes explained in this policy.
